APRIL 21ST
1959 – 1211-kg great white shark becomes largest fish ever caught on a rod
1960 – Brasilia becomes capital of Brazil
1960 – Founding of the Orthodox Bahá’í Faith in Washington, D.C.
1963 – The Universal House of Justice of the Bahá’í Faith is elected for the first time.
1983 – 1 pound coin introduced in United Kingdom
1993 – Brazil votes against a monarchy
1994 – The first discoveries of extrasolar planets are announced by astronomer Alexander Wolszczan.
2013 – 185 people are killed in a conflict between Islamic extremists and the Nigerian military
